Kim Louise King, 62, of Madras, passed away May 26, 2021, at her home in Madras. She was born October 4, 1958, to parents, Art and June Siwicki in Detroit, Michigan. Kim graduated high school in Hamilton, Montana, and received a BS degree from OSU in Human Development and Family Service.
Kim married Jesse King on June 12, 1980, in Salmon, Idaho. They lived in Wyoming, Montana, and moved to Madras in 1991.
Kim was a home maker, waitress, hotel clerk, and CASA volunteer; which is what inspired her to get her degree later in life.
Her interests were kids and animals. Kim always had a soft spot in her heart for underdogs and strays. She was always trying to make things better for them.
Kim is survived by her spouse, Jesse; daughter, Janile (Travis) Yost of Silverton; son, Jacob (Danielle) King of Caldwell, Idaho; grandchildren, Declan Yost, George and Arthur King.
She was preceded in death by her parents.
A celebration of life will be held August 14, at 1 p.m. at the Sahalee Park Pavilion. Burial was held at Mount Jefferson Memorial Park Cemetery. Contributions can be made to any Humane Society or children's organization.
